Caring for Your Aging Loved Ones by Focus on the Family
|
Practical information you need and a spiritual and emotional lifeline. Topics include burnout: physical, emotional, and mental; changes in aging; medical, financial, and legal help; elder abuse; choosing a care facility; and end-of-life decisions. Caregivers will also learn what the Bible says about caregiving and the keys to effectively fulfilling that role.

Mayo Clinic On Alzheimer's Disease by Ronald Petersen
|
This book covers how your brain functions and what can go wrong, current theories about what causes Alzheimer's, new Alzheimer's treatments, and much more.

An Unfortunate Stroke of Luck by Tami Regan
|
This is "A Guidebook for Stroke Sufferers and Their Families and Friends" that explains the events and challenges that a stroke sufferer might expect during the hospital stay while also offering ideas about helpful activities within which family and friends should understand and engage in order to provide a helpful role to the stroke sufferer.

Ministering to the Mourning by David & Warren Wiersbe
|
This is "A Practical Guide for Pastors, Church Leaders, and Other Caregivers" providing insightful and practical advice for dealing with grief process and learn to recognize the signs of both healthy and unhealthy grief.
